Restarting Clopidogrel After Subdural Hemorrhage in a Stroke Patient

For a patient on clopidogrel for secondary stroke prevention who develops a traumatic subdural hemorrhage, restart clopidogrel 2–4 weeks after the trauma if the hematoma is stable on repeat imaging and there is no planned neurosurgical intervention. 1

Risk Stratification and Timing Framework

Immediate Assessment (Days 0–7)

  • Stop clopidogrel immediately upon diagnosis of subdural hemorrhage, as active intracranial hemorrhage is an absolute contraindication to antiplatelet therapy. 2
  • Obtain baseline CT imaging to document hematoma size and characteristics. 1
  • Assess for need for neurosurgical evacuation; patients requiring surgery should have clopidogrel held until hemostasis is achieved post-operatively. 2

Early Monitoring Period (Days 7–14)

  • Obtain repeat head CT at approximately 7–10 days to assess for hematoma progression. 3
  • Patients on preinjury clopidogrel have a 5-fold increased risk of hematoma progression (OR 5.1,95% CI 3.1–7.1) and nearly 2-fold increased risk of requiring neurosurgical intervention (OR 1.8,95% CI 1.4–3.1). 3
  • During this period, the risk of thrombotic/thromboembolic events begins to rise, particularly in patients with coronary artery disease (6.1% vs 1.0% in controls, P=0.02). 1

Decision Window for Restart (Weeks 2–4)

The median time to restart antiplatelet therapy after traumatic subdural hematoma is 2–4 weeks, with the specific timing determined by: 1

  • Hematoma stability on repeat imaging: No expansion or new bleeding on CT performed at 2 weeks post-trauma
  • Clinical indication urgency: Patients with recent stroke (within 90 days) or high-risk TIA warrant earlier restart (closer to 2 weeks) given the time-sensitive benefit of dual antiplatelet therapy 4
  • Absence of ongoing neurological deterioration: Stable or improving GCS and focal deficits

Restart Protocol Based on Original Indication

For Patients Who Were on Dual Antiplatelet Therapy (DAPT) for Recent Minor Stroke/TIA

If the subdural hemorrhage occurred within the original 21-day DAPT window: 4

  • Resume clopidogrel 75 mg daily (maintenance dose only, no loading dose) at 2–3 weeks post-trauma if imaging is stable 1
  • Resume aspirin 75–100 mg daily concurrently 5
  • Complete the remaining days of the 21-day DAPT course, then transition to single antiplatelet therapy 4
  • The pooled CHANCE/POINT data show that DAPT benefit is confined to the first 21 days (HR 0.66,95% CI 0.56–0.77), so any interruption should be minimized. 4

For Patients on Long-Term Clopidogrel Monotherapy for Secondary Stroke Prevention

  • Restart clopidogrel 75 mg daily at 2–4 weeks post-trauma without a loading dose 2, 1
  • The FDA label specifies that for established stroke, the maintenance dose is 75 mg once daily without loading. 2
  • Do not reload with 300–600 mg, as this markedly increases hemorrhagic risk in the immediate post-subdural period without providing additional platelet inhibition after only a 2–4 week interruption. 5

Balancing Hemorrhagic vs Thrombotic Risk

Hemorrhagic Risk Considerations

  • The rate of unplanned hematoma re-evacuation within 90 days is not significantly different between patients who restart antiplatelet therapy and those who do not (6.9% APT alone vs 6.4% control, P=NS). 1
  • This suggests that restarting at 2–4 weeks does not substantially increase the risk of recurrent bleeding if imaging confirms stability. 1

Thrombotic Risk Considerations

  • Delaying restart beyond 4 weeks significantly increases thrombotic/thromboembolic events, particularly in high-risk populations: 1
    • Patients with coronary artery disease: 6.1% thrombosis rate vs 1.0% control (P=0.02)
    • Patients with atrial fibrillation requiring anticoagulation: 10.1% vs 1.0% control (P<0.001)
  • For stroke patients specifically, the risk of recurrent ischemic stroke is highest in the first 90 days, making prolonged interruption of antiplatelet therapy particularly hazardous. 4

Special Circumstances and Contraindications

Absolute Contraindications to Restart

  • Active bleeding or hematoma expansion on repeat imaging 2
  • Planned neurosurgical intervention within the next 5 days 2
  • Severe thrombocytopenia or coagulopathy 2

Relative Contraindications Requiring Individualized Assessment

  • Large subdural hematoma (>10 mm thickness) even if stable 3
  • Concurrent need for anticoagulation (e.g., atrial fibrillation); in these cases, consider delaying anticoagulation restart to 4–6 weeks and using antiplatelet therapy as a bridge 1
  • Age >75 years with multiple falls, where recurrent trauma risk is high 3

Monitoring After Restart

  • Obtain repeat head CT at 1 week after restarting clopidogrel to confirm no delayed rebleeding 1
  • Educate patient on signs of intracranial hemorrhage (severe headache, altered mental status, focal deficits) and instruct to seek immediate care 2
  • Consider gastric protection with a proton pump inhibitor if restarting DAPT, as gastrointestinal bleeding risk increases (0.9% vs 0.4% with aspirin alone). 6

Common Pitfalls to Avoid

  • Do not restart clopidogrel before 2 weeks unless the subdural was extremely small and the stroke indication is urgent (e.g., crescendo TIAs); even then, aspirin monotherapy is safer initially 1
  • Do not give a loading dose when restarting after a 2–4 week interruption, as standard 75 mg daily dosing is appropriate and loading increases bleeding risk 5, 2
  • Do not delay restart beyond 4 weeks in patients with recent stroke, as thrombotic risk escalates sharply and outweighs hemorrhagic risk once imaging confirms stability 1
  • Do not restart clopidogrel if the patient requires urgent surgery; wait until hemostasis is achieved post-operatively 2
